MEMORANDUM OPINION

KAPLAN, District Judge.

This libel case arises out of a series of televised investigative reports. The television station and its reporter suggested that plaintiff, a member of the Colombian Senate who also is a physician practicing in the New York area, touts credentials which "are largely invented."1 The claim, in essence, is that Dr. López's resume substantially exaggerates his credentials and experience...
